Distance from Dubai to Singapore
π¦πͺ Dubai, United Arab Emirates β πΈπ¬ Singapore, Singapore
The distance between Dubai and Singapore is 5,837 kilometres (3,627 miles) measured as a great-circle (straight) line. Flying out of Dubai International Airport (DXB), the initial heading is roughly east (109Β°), and a typical nonstop flight takes around 7h 48m. Actual flight paths and times vary with routing, winds and air-traffic constraints.
